Transaction 7331eebc1102abea4d3015cec0de6facdd53a734325cf6bd920575e412795695

2 Input
2 Outputs
  • 7331eebc1102abea4d3015cec0de6facdd53a734325cf6bd920575e412795695:0
  • value  6874106
    address  1MiFVYr1fUmu5sFQnsFwZ5XLykvpLhzRM8
  • 7331eebc1102abea4d3015cec0de6facdd53a734325cf6bd920575e412795695:1
  • value  60000000
    address  3LsmBD6MSrc6uqsZgntW3y78p7Rw31PcZ9